Bali Beach Hotel: Sofitel

Uncategorized November 2, 2015

Remember me talking about one of the Top Ten Brunches in the World? Well this is where you can find it! If you travel to Bali I definitely recommend spending part of your trip in the Nusa Dua area. It’s perfect for relaxing and being pampered, and has a seemingly never-ending selection of amazing food. The hotel we stayed at was Sofitel and we loved every. single. second of it.

Here is what you can expect there:

Probably the most friendly and helpful staff I’ve ever encountered.

You’ll be greeted in your room with a lovely array of fruits, champagne (or sparkling water…), and my favorite: a chocolate vine bearing “fruit” in the form of macarons and truffles. Beautiful and delicious.

The most extensive pool I’ve seen: below is a photo from our balcony, and as you can see our wide-angle couldn’t nearly capture all of this glorious water wonderland.

A short walk to the beach and beach restaurant, which was delish and so fun to enjoy at nighttime with the strung lanterns and sound of the waves.

Access to several restaurants inside the hotel that include afternoon tea, the famous weekend brunch (which you should not miss if you travel to Bali!), and my favorite part of every day there: the breakfast buffet. I feel like the word ‘buffet’ tends to have negative connotations to it, like they are just factories that pump out massive amounts of cheap food. But after Sofitel, my feelings on buffets have been very much elevated. I’ll post more on that later, but just know that if you stay here to make sure and get a breakfast package, you will not regret it.
